Output 508a2106508fc2ef24b4d95e696388c52f43f2222c1215be83c49b9d2ff26993:0

value
31284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f15bfdde399de038e04211026e2b2c04019613 OP_EQUAL
address
384qginFUXxPXdswYGPjHMcfsXhmAVWPFS
transaction
508a2106508fc2ef24b4d95e696388c52f43f2222c1215be83c49b9d2ff26993
confirmations
375021
spent
true